Barclays' CEO Sounds Bullish Note On Wealth Management Prospects

Barclays has singled out its wealth management business, Barclays Wealth, for growth during this year and is one of the two areas where shareholders will see expansion, the banking group’s chief executive has said.
The [wealth] business has seen double-digit growth in revenues and profit before tax over the past two years, Bob Diamond told Bloomberg Television.
“Tom Kalaris who runs that business with us has a very specific five-year plan to move that business into the top tier and it should continue to see double-digit growth,” he was reported as saying.
Besides wealth management, Africa is another area earmarked for significant growth, he said.
Hires continue at
Barclays Wealth. The firm has made two UK-based hires hot on
the heels of this morning’s announcement of a new head of wealth
for Saudi Arabia in the shape of Faisal Shaker. It continued the
expansion of its ultra high net worth team with the appointment
of Rupert Howard as senior portfolio manager in the London
office.
On the other hand, Barclays Wealth plans to cut nearly 100 jobs as a result of a review of the company’s activities, according to a spokesperson for the company. The job cuts will affect back and middle-office staff across several jurisdictions.
